After win, Granholm says plan for Michigan is validated

Detroit Free Press:
"Gov. Jennifer Granholm said this morning her re-election was voters’ validation of her economic plan for Michigan.

She also said Democratic victories are a strong message to President George W. Bush that his policies are wrong for the nation.

“His plan is not the plan of the citizens of this country, and he needs to change direction,” she told reporters at a Detroit restaurant, 11 hours after she triumphantly declared victory Tuesday night.

Appearing rested and with her family joining her for breakfast, Granholm said she can better move forward her plans with a Democratic House.
